Fortunately Edison's mother - a former school teacher herself - was a pioneer in true learning. Says The World Book Encyclopedia: "She had the notion, unusual for those times, that learning could be fun. She made a game of teaching him - she called it exploring - the exciting world of knowledge. The boy was surprised at first, and then delighted.
